It is essential to read the installation instructions specific to your particular fireplace prior to beginning. They may differ slightly from the instructions we provide, but will help you follow the correct steps for a safe and efficient installation. Make sure your wall can support the weight of the fireplace. It is a good idea to have at least two studs in your wall and to use drywall anchors if necessary. Also, make sure you have a three-spot electrical outlet within reach of your fireplace's cord.
When considering where to install your wall-mounted electric fireplace, it is crucial to remember that these units can be used in any space, so it is indoors and not in direct contact with moisture or water. Avoid placing these units in close proximity to anything that could ignite, like curtains and drapes.

When deciding between a recessed or wall-mounted electric fireplace, you'll have to consider the style and décor of your space. A fireplace with a recess is suitable for any room but it's not as versatile as the wall-mounted model.
A wall-mounted fireplace can be installed on top of the wall or built into it. It is much easier to install a wall-mounted electric fireplace than a recessed one because it doesn't require cutting into the studs of the wall or re-inforcing it. It will require an electrical outlet nearby to plug in the unit.
